Market Overview:


The global wideband couplers market is expected to grow at a CAGR of 5.5% from 2018 to 2030. The growth in the market can be attributed to the increasing demand for wideband directional couplers and hybrid couplers in defense and aerospace applications. Additionally, the growing demand for wireless communication systems is also contributing to the growth of the global wideband coupler market. North America dominates the global wideband coupler market, followed by Europe and Asia Pacific.

Product Definition:


Wideband couplers are passive devices that allow for the distribution of a signal over a wide frequency range. They are typically used in RF and microwave applications to couple signals between two or more circuits. Wideband couplers can be used to combine signals, split signals, or do both at the same time.
